Overview

The LDZX-50FAS is a vertically oriented, flip-top lid steam sterilizer engineered for reliable, repeatable moist-heat sterilization under saturated steam conditions at elevated pressure and temperature. It operates on the fundamental principle of thermal inactivation—utilizing pressurized saturated steam to achieve microbial lethality through protein denaturation and nucleic acid disruption. Designed to meet ISO 17665-1:2019 (Sterilization of health care products — Moist heat — Part 1: Requirements for the development, validation and routine control of a sterilization process for medical devices), the unit delivers validated sterilization cycles suitable for laboratory-grade instruments, surgical dressings, glassware, culture media, pharmaceutical solutions, and food samples. Its robust stainless-steel construction (AISI 304 grade chamber and outer casing), integrated automatic control logic, and mechanical safety redundancies ensure compliance with GLP and basic GMP environmental requirements in academic, clinical, and industrial R&D settings.

Sample Compatibility & Compliance

The LDZX-50FAS accommodates standard laboratory load configurations including wrapped instrument sets, unsealed Petri dishes, liquid-filled flasks (with vented caps), autoclavable plastic containers, and pre-packaged sterile barrier systems. Load geometry must conform to EN 285:2015 Clause 6.2.3 (maximum height-to-diameter ratio ≤ 2.5) to ensure uniform steam penetration. The unit supports gravity displacement air removal and is not rated for vacuum-assisted pre-vacuum cycles. It complies with national Chinese standards YY 0504–2005 (Horizontal/Vertical Steam Sterilizers) and meets essential performance criteria referenced in FDA Guidance for Industry: Sterile Drug Products Produced by Aseptic Processing (2004). While not independently certified to ISO 13485 or CE-MDR, its design aligns with foundational sterilization process controls required for ISO 9001:2015 quality management systems.

Software & Data Management

The LDZX-50FAS operates via embedded firmware without external PC connectivity or proprietary software. All cycle parameters are stored in non-volatile memory and retain settings after power interruption. Cycle logs—including start time, set temperature, actual chamber temperature profile (recorded at 10-second intervals), elapsed time, and end status—are viewable on the front-panel LCD but not exportable. For regulated environments requiring audit trails, users may integrate optional third-party USB data loggers compatible with RS-232 output (available as accessory). The system supports basic electronic recordkeeping aligned with FDA 21 CFR Part 11 principles when paired with validated documentation workflows, though native electronic signature or user-role authentication is not implemented.

FAQ

What is the maximum recommended load volume for optimal sterilization efficacy?
The chamber’s 50 L internal volume supports up to 40 L of porous load (e.g., wrapped instruments) or 35 L of liquid load (e.g., 500 mL flasks filled to 80% capacity) to maintain adequate steam circulation and condensate drainage.
Does this unit support programmable multi-step cycles (e.g., liquid vs. solid modes)?
No—it provides a single fixed-cycle architecture optimized for saturated steam exposure. Separate cycle optimization for liquids requires manual parameter adjustment per load type and is not automated.
Is the pressure gauge calibrated and traceable to national standards?
The dual-scale gauge is factory-calibrated and supplied with a manufacturer’s calibration certificate. Field recalibration is recommended annually using NIST-traceable deadweight testers per ISO 6789-2:2017.
Can the LDZX-50FAS be installed in a fume hood or ventilated enclosure?
No—exhaust steam must be discharged into a dedicated floor drain or condensate collection system. Installation requires ambient room ventilation meeting ASHRAE 110 guidelines for heat dissipation and humidity control.
What maintenance intervals are recommended for long-term reliability?
Daily: Visual inspection of gasket integrity and chamber cleanliness. Monthly: Verification of pressure relief valve operation and water level sensor response. Annually: Full system performance qualification (SPQ) including Bowie-Dick test, Helix test, and biological indicator challenge (Geobacillus stearothermophilus spores).
